Understanding the difference between these two warranties is essential for ensuring your construction or remodeling project is fully protected. They serve complementary roles by covering different aspects of the work:
- Workmanship Warranty: Provided by the contractor or remodeler, this covers the installation and labor. It protects against errors such as misaligned cabinets, improperly sealed fixtures, or finishing flaws (e.g., drywall cracking or paint peeling) resulting from faulty application. While the industry norm is often one to two years, higher-standard providers may offer a five-year workmanship warranty.
- Material Warranty: Provided by the manufacturer or supplier, this covers the physical products themselves. It protects against manufacturing faults, such as delaminating countertops, faulty window seals, or appliance malfunctions. The duration varies by product and can range from one year to a lifetime.
Key Differences at a Glance:
- Responsibility: The contractor stands behind the installation (workmanship), while the manufacturer backs the product quality (materials).
- Claim Process: For workmanship issues, you contact your contractor directly. For material defects, you must file a claim with the manufacturer, which typically requires proof of purchase and evidence of professional installation.
- Exclusions: Neither warranty typically covers normal wear and tear, damage from misuse, or external factors like soil movement or acts of nature.
